Medha is a Rural village located in Lal-bahadur-nagar, Rajnandgaon, Chhattisgarh.
The total population of Medha is 2,609.
Medha village comprises 534 households.
The literacy rate in Medha is 72%. Among the literate population of 1,601, there are 883 literate males and 718 literate females.
In Medha, there are 1,273 males and 1,336 females, with a sex ratio of 1049 females per 1000 males.
There are 386 children (14.8% of population), comprising 195 boys and 191 girls.
The total number of workers in Medha is 1,493, with 1,045 main workers and 448 marginal workers.
In Medha, there are 271 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(120 males, 151 females) and 782 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(372 males, 410 females).
Medha is located in Chhattisgarh state, Rajnandgaon district, and falls under Lal-bahadur-nagar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 440696 and LGD code is 440696.
